BTG/USD chart - Trading View
Exchange - Binance
Support: 17.6586 (50-DMA); Resistance: 25.7401 (61.8% Fib)
Technical Analysis: Bias Bullish
Bitcoin Gold trades 3.5% lower at 23.5393 at 11:20 GMT
The pair has paused gains at 61.8% Fib and finds stiff resistance at 24.5700 (trendline)
Momentum studies are still bullish, no major signs of reversal seen
RSI is at overbought levels and has turned south, scope for some consolidation
A 'Golden Cross' formation on the daily charts keeps bias bullish
Break above 61.8% Fib will see next major resistance at 78.6% Fib at 30.3595
50-DMA is major support at 17.66, bias will turn bearish on breach below 200-DMA
